The contract involves the procurement and delivery of a single registered American Quarter Horse Association (AQHA) stallion or mare, which must have been born between 2011 and 2024 and stand at least 14 hands high. This subcontract is issued by the Texas Department of Criminal Justice and is categorized under NAICS code 112930, indicating it is related to equine procurement or livestock supply. Respondents are required to submit their proposals by August 31, 2026.
